“I’m a Big Sissy, Man”- Jorge Masvidal Reveals How He Feels About the Coronavirus

Published 04/10/2020, 3:02 PM EDT

Follow Us

As the whole world rushes towards confinement in light of the devastating coronavirus, “Gamebred” Jorge Masvidal shared with BT Sports what he is doing to escape the virus.

Employing the only available strategy, Masvidal, too, is confining restricting himself to the walls of his house. He stated that he is warier of going out than most other people are.

On being asked about the situation around him and what his views are, he said,

“It’s still alarming me to me man. I do research on it. And I hear [that] if you catch it, it could take up [a] certain lung capacity from you, you know if you had it to a certain extent. So, just as an athlete, I’m extra paranoid not to go out [or] not to go anywhere.”

Masvidal is taking the threat that the pandemic poses with utmost seriousness. And, of course, what he said about an athlete’s health is spot-on.

The virus is said to deteriorate a person’s breathability to a bare minimum. Now, while it is not confirmed whether those effects continue in some form even after cure, the amount of energy it drains from a person over the course of its stay in the body is enormous. This can be especially drastic for sportspersons, who need to maintain their fitness and health at the paramount level at all times.

Jorge Masvidal keeping his workout largely indoors

Carrying on with the interview, Masvidal said, “I do most of my work out, too. What I do outside is just run [on] the street. I’m a big sissy, man. I’m at home, as you see. And I’ll be home. Actually, some of my friends make fun of me. Because I’m more of the radical one, you know. F*ck it. If I can train at home, why risk going out?”

An important lesson from Gamebred here. No one is immune to the coronavirus. Thus, the real heroism is in staying indoors and keeping everyone safe.
